The Granby Care Home Brings the Community Together

Posted: Jul 24th 2026

By: Harbour Healthcare

The Granby Care Home recently welcomed local residents, community organisations and support services for its Harrogate Community Connections Fair, an event designed to strengthen community links and raise awareness of the wide range of support available across the local area.

Held in the home’s historic Ballroom, the fair brought together a diverse range of organisations, offering visitors the opportunity to explore local services, access advice and connect with groups that play an important role in supporting the Harrogate community.

Organisations attending the event included Able to Enable, Full Circle Funeral Services, Specsavers, Move It or Lose It Exercise Group, Occupational Therapy, St Michael’s Hospice, U3A Harrogate, Realise Training, TAO Staffing Solutions, Cucumber Recruitment and our own recruitment team.

The event also welcomed the Mayor of Harrogate, who spent time meeting stall holders, speaking with visitors and learning more about the valuable work being carried out by organisations across the region.

Throughout the afternoon, visitors had the opportunity to discover local services, ask questions, gather information and make new connections in a welcoming and relaxed environment. The event reflected The Granby Care Home’s ongoing commitment to opening its doors to the wider community and creating opportunities for people to come together.
